Question:
In the event of the dissolution of Company A, what will be the return ratio of our capital contribution?
Answer
After settling all debts and dissolution-related expenses includes:
- Salary arrears, severance pay, social insurance, health insurance, unemployment insurance as prescribed by law, and other benefits under collective labor agreements and signed labor contracts;
- Tax liabilities;
- Other debts such as payables to suppliers, partners, customers, etc.,
The remaining assets will be distributed among the members of the company in proportion to their capital contribution.
As a shareholder holding 30% of the charter capital, your company will be entitled to receive a portion of the remaining assets equivalent to your ownership ratio, after Company A has fulfilled all its financial obligations.
